Do You Have to Warm Up Formula Every Time?

Formula feeding doesn't always require warming. Room temperature formula is perfectly safe for consumption and poses no health risks when properly prepared. Most babies can adapt to different temperatures with patience and consistency.

The question "do you have to warm up the formula" has a flexible answer. The room temperature formula remains nutritionally complete and safe. Pediatricians confirm that babies can safely consume formula at various temperatures without concerns.

Several factors influence warming decisions:

  • Temperature preferences vary among babies. Some children prefer temperatures that mimic breast milk warmth, while others accept room temperature formulas without issue.

  • Gentle warming works best. When warming is preferred, proper methods create comfortable feeding experiences without compromising safety.

  • Always test the temperature. Safe warming involves placing sealed bottles in warm water baths or using specialized bottle warmers. The wrist test ensures proper temperature - formula should feel lukewarm, never hot.

Babies often adapt to consistent temperatures over time. If a child refuses room temperature formula, gentle warming typically resolves feeding difficulties while maintaining safety standards.

How Long Is a Warmed Formula Bottle Good For?

Proper formula handling significantly impacts infant health and nutrition. Parents need clear guidance about warming safety, especially when babies develop temperature preferences.

The critical question "how long is a warmed formula bottle good for" has a definitive answer: warmed formula remains safe for up to two hours at room temperature. Beyond this timeframe, rapid bacterial growth makes the formula unsafe for consumption. Warm environments create ideal conditions for harmful bacteria multiplication, potentially causing serious digestive issues.

Essential safety guidelines include:

  • Time limits matter. Prepared bottles should never remain at room temperature beyond two hours due to significant bacterial growth risks. Harmful bacteria multiply exponentially in warm environments, doubling every 20-30 minutes. Even if formula appears fine, invisible bacterial contamination can cause severe digestive upset, vomiting, or diarrhea in babies whose immune systems are still developing.

  • No refrigeration after warming. Previously warmed formula should never return to refrigeration, as temperature cycling increases contamination risks. The warming and cooling process creates ideal conditions for pathogenic bacteria to establish colonies. Once formula has been heated, its protective properties become compromised, making it vulnerable to rapid bacterial multiplication that refrigeration cannot stop.

  • Avoid temperature fluctuations. Consistent temperatures prevent dangerous bacterial growth that thrives in fluctuating conditions. Temperature variations between hot and cold create stress on formula proteins while encouraging harmful microorganisms to proliferate. Maintaining steady temperatures preserves nutritional integrity and prevents the formation of toxic bacterial byproducts that can seriously harm infants.

Understanding "how long a warmed up formula is good for" helps parents protect their babies effectively. Planning smaller portions based on typical consumption patterns reduces waste while maintaining safety standards.

Can You Reheat Formula Twice? What Parents Need to Know

Parents wonder "can I reheat formula" multiple times to avoid waste. The answer is clear: formulas should only be reheated once for safety reasons. Multiple reheating cycles create serious health risks that parents must understand.

The question "can you reheat formula twice" has a definitive no. Multiple heating cycles pose several risks:

  • Bacterial contamination increases. After initial reheating, formula becomes a breeding ground for harmful bacteria that multiply rapidly in warm conditions.

  • Nutritional degradation occurs. Repeated heating destroys essential vitamins and proteins necessary for healthy development. Heat breaks down crucial protective compounds found in quality formulas.

  • Taste and texture changes. Multiple heating cycles alter formula consistency, making it unpalatable for sensitive babies and potentially causing feeding difficulties.

Understanding "can formula be reheated" properly helps establish correct feeding processes. Parents should prepare smaller portions based on feeding patterns to minimize waste while avoiding dangerous reheating practices. Fresh preparation for each feeding session ensures optimal nutrition and safety.

Safe Methods to Warm Up Formula

Parents asking "can you heat up formula" safely should understand proper techniques that preserve nutritional integrity. Knowing whether "can you use bottle warmer for formula" helps choose reliable warming methods.

Proven safe warming methods include:

  • Warm water bath. This method provides even, gentle heating that maintains nutritional composition while ensuring consistent temperature distribution throughout the bottle.

  • Bottle warmer devices. Specialized warmers designed for infant feeding offer controlled heating with automatic shut-off features that prevent overheating while ensuring accurate temperature control.

  • Warm running water. Running sealed bottles under warm tap water gradually brings formula to comfortable feeding temperature while allowing temperature monitoring.

  • Steam warmers. Electric steam warmers use gentle steam heat to warm bottles evenly without creating hot spots. These devices typically include timer settings and automatic shut-off functions that ensure consistent results while preserving formula nutrients.

  • Car bottle warmers. Portable 12V warmers designed for travel plug into vehicle power outlets, providing safe heating during car trips or outings. These compact devices maintain steady temperatures and prevent formula from getting too hot while away from home.

Methods to completely avoid:

  • Never use microwaves. Microwaves create dangerous hot spots and uneven heating that can burn babies while destroying nutritional compounds.

  • Avoid stovetop heating. Stovetop methods prove problematic due to difficulty controlling temperature and overheating risks.

  • Don't use hot water from the tap. Hot tap water often exceeds safe temperatures and may contain bacteria or mineral deposits from water heater tanks that can contaminate formula and harm babies.

  • Never heat in direct sunlight. Leaving bottles in cars, windowsills, or direct sunlight creates unpredictable heating that can reach dangerous temperatures while promoting rapid bacterial growth in warm conditions.

Best Practices for Storing and Handling Formula

Understanding the "can you warm up formula" correctly requires knowing proper storage with strict temperature controls. Questions like "can I warm up formula" and "can you re warm formula" become important for maintaining baby health while minimizing contamination risks.

Essential storage practices include:

  • Thorough cleaning. Bottles require washing with hot, soapy water after each use to remove residue and prevent bacterial buildup.

  • Complete drying. Ensure bottles dry completely before reuse to prevent moisture-related contamination.

  • Single reheating rule. Understanding "how many times can you reheat unused formula" is crucial - the answer is only once, and only if the formula hasn't been offered to the baby.

Freshly prepared formula can remain safely refrigerated for up to 24 hours in clean, sealed containers. After this period, discard unused formula and clean all equipment thoroughly.
